HOW EACH SALE IS PRICED
The same $50 sale costs more on a rewards card, and on tiered pricing more again, because your processor can move those cards into a costlier tier.

LEASES NOBODY MENTIONED
A basic terminal on a 48 month lease can cost $3,312, and many leases can’t be cancelled early. I check what you pay for hardware too.

WHAT NOBODY CAN CUT
Interchange is set by Visa and Mastercard and paid to the bank that issued each card. Nobody negotiates the rates, but I check your sales qualify for the lowest ones: batches closed daily, address checks, business card data.
